diff options
author | isaacs <i@izs.me> | 2012-02-27 10:59:35 -0800 |
---|---|---|
committer | isaacs <i@izs.me> | 2012-02-27 10:59:35 -0800 |
commit | 7d6d5e263e8cea5c34f6cb6947e7264ced0d6381 (patch) | |
tree | 981109ba189dc1ac11defd0dea3599f2c2a77c60 /Makefile | |
parent | 964d03bc3f09dbbdcd1569fbf63bc03f67542f08 (diff) | |
download | nodejs-7d6d5e263e8cea5c34f6cb6947e7264ced0d6381.tar.gz nodejs-7d6d5e263e8cea5c34f6cb6947e7264ced0d6381.tar.bz2 nodejs-7d6d5e263e8cea5c34f6cb6947e7264ced0d6381.zip |
Use new doc generation tool
Diffstat (limited to 'Makefile')
-rw-r--r-- | Makefile | 12 |
1 files changed, 8 insertions, 4 deletions
@@ -92,7 +92,8 @@ test-npm-publish: node npm_package_config_publishtest=true ./node deps/npm/test/run.js apidoc_sources = $(wildcard doc/api/*.markdown) -apidocs = $(addprefix out/,$(apidoc_sources:.markdown=.html)) +apidocs = $(addprefix out/,$(apidoc_sources:.markdown=.html)) \ + $(addprefix out/,$(apidoc_sources:.markdown=.json)) apidoc_dirs = out/doc out/doc/api/ out/doc/api/assets out/doc/about out/doc/community out/doc/logos out/doc/images @@ -115,7 +116,7 @@ website_files = \ out/doc/logos/index.html \ $(doc_images) -doc: node $(apidoc_dirs) $(website_files) $(apiassets) $(apidocs) +doc: node $(apidoc_dirs) $(website_files) $(apiassets) $(apidocs) tools/doc/ $(apidoc_dirs): mkdir -p $@ @@ -126,8 +127,11 @@ out/doc/api/assets/%: doc/api_assets/% out/doc/api/assets/ out/doc/%: doc/% cp -r $< $@ -out/doc/api/%.html: doc/api/%.markdown node $(apidoc_dirs) $(apiassets) tools/doctool/doctool.js - out/Release/node tools/doctool/doctool.js doc/template.html $< > $@ +out/doc/api/%.json: doc/api/%.markdown + out/Release/node tools/doc/generate.js --format=json $< > $@ + +out/doc/api/%.html: doc/api/%.markdown + out/Release/node tools/doc/generate.js --format=html --template=doc/template.html $< > $@ website-upload: doc rsync -r out/doc/ node@nodejs.org:~/web/nodejs.org/ |